What will you be doing?
- You review Balance Sheet reconciliations prepared by local finance teams and lead VAT returns and reconciliations (UK and Irish).
- You manage divisional cashflow consolidation, variance analysis, and provide commentary for Group reporting.
- You lead year-end reporting into the Group Control Team, including stat packs, adjustments, and TB to Stat mapping reconciliations.
- You conduct tax analysis, including Corporation Tax and RDEC.
- You oversee intercompany relationships, loans, recharges, and reconciliations.
- You manage fixed and intangible asset registers, finance lease schedules, depreciation, amortisation, and impairment reviews.
- You monitor bonus accruals, ensure compliance reporting, lead month-end reporting, approve journals, close ledgers, support forecasting, audits, controls, projects, and manage one direct report.
- Strong knowledge of FRS102, IFRS, accounting principles, and tax (VAT and Corporation Tax).
- Experienced Financial Control professional with over three years’ experience, ACA/ACCA qualified.
- Skilled in process review, testing, and using Microsoft tools (Excel, Teams, Outlook, Word, PowerPoint).
- Communicates effectively, influences senior stakeholders, and demonstrates leadership.
- Proactive, organised, and self-motivated, with strong time management and a flexible, team-oriented approach.
- Experience presenting to management.
- Desirable: knowledge of CIS and VAT Domestic Reverse Charge, Oracle/PBCS, utilities or construction sectors, Group/shared services environments, and audit background.
